Transaction 08758b79cd7ec9153444fa52be72ed36640dcf63f5ca1f162951803684454664
1 Input
1 Output
-
08758b79cd7ec9153444fa52be72ed36640dcf63f5ca1f162951803684454664:0
- value
- 164399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ae23cdab23a7fcbaee9b7b7afd7e8c81bda9a466 OP_EQUAL
- address
- 3HZnPav91bk5guykGUMVZkLx8N1mZqxquQ